Another thing to try is a Force Restart.


  • Press and quickly release the volume up button.
  • Press and quickly release the volume down button.
  • Press and hold the side button until you see the Apple logo

This usually means an issue with the iPhone screen digitizer, and that it needs to be replaced. Note that the iPhone 12 isn't "new" and that you should take it back to whoever you purchased it for a refund or exchange.


Otherwise, make an appointment at your nearest Apple Store's Genius Bar or an Apple Authorized Service Provider for service.
